    • A method for purifying a modified major mite allergen obtained by the genetic recombination technique and a purified modified major mite allergen obtained by said method for purification are provided. A method for purifying a modified major mite allergen obtained by the genetic recombination technique, which comprises the purification steps: (1) Washing and recovering inclusion bodies containing a modified major mite allergen obtained by the genetic recombination technique with MF membrane; (2) Dissolving said inclusion bodies followed by refolding; (3) Concentrating a solution containing the modified major mite allergen with simultaneous removal of low molecular weight components with ultrafiltration membrane; (4) Recovering the modified major mite allergen in non-adsorbed fractions with an anion exchanger; (5) Recovering the modified major mite allergen in adsorbed fractions with a hydrophobic gel; and (6) Recovering the modified major mite allergen in adsorbed fractions with an anion exchanger, and a modified major mite allergen with high purity obtained by said method for purification.
    • 提供了通过遗传重组技术获得的改良的主要螨变应原的纯化方法和通过所述纯化方法获得的纯化的改良的主要螨变应原。 一种用于纯化通过遗传重组技术获得的改性主要螨变应原的方法,其包括纯化步骤:(1)洗涤并回收含有通过MF膜的遗传重组技术获得的修饰的主要螨变应原的包含体; (2)溶解所述包涵体,然后重折叠; (3)浓缩含有改性主要螨变应原的溶液,同时用超滤膜除去低分子量成分; (4)用阴离子交换剂回收未吸附级分的改性主要螨变应原; (5)用疏水凝胶回收吸附级分中的改性主要螨变应原; 和(6)用阴离子交换剂回收吸附级分中的改性主要螨变应原,以及通过所述纯化方法获得的具有高纯度的改性主要螨变应原。
